India, May 1 -- In a high-profile hearing in a California federal court, Elon Musk said it was "partly" true that xAI had used OpenAI's models in the development of its own Artificial Intelligence (AI) systems.

The exchange came during the ongoing legal battle between Musk and OpenAI. Under questioning by OpenAI lawyer William Savitt, Musk was asked whether xAI had used distillation techniques involving OpenAI models. Musk first said such practices were common across the AI industry. When pressed further, he reportedly replied, "Partly."
